How To Make Low Carb Muffins

Use your blender!

Whipping up your keto muffin batter in a blender makes it more cohesive, lighter and fluffier. You can still do this recipe in a bowl, whisking your ingredients together, if you prefer.

Add sour cream for tenderness

I can’t recommend sour cream enough as an ingredient in keto cakes and muffins. It gives them a wonderful texture, with no need for any butter or other oil. Greek yogurt also works well.

Blend the wet ingredients first

Get the eggs, sour cream, and vanilla extract well blended first, before adding the dry ingredients. Then you can add the dry all at once and blend again until smooth.

Let cool completely after baking

This is a tough one for people who love baked goods hot out of the oven. But all keto baked goods hold together better after they cool properly.

Customize these muffins!

You aren’t restricted to cranberries and pecans in this recipe. Let your imagination run wild! Lemon blueberry, cranberry orange, chocolate chip, you name it. You can use this as a basic low carb muffin recipe and add in whatever you want.

Low carb muffins store well too

Muffins like these are great for stocking your freezer. Simply place them into a ziplock freezer bag and freeze. They can last for several months. They can also be refrigerated for up to a week for easy keto breakfasts.

Cranberries are great for low carb and keto diets

  • Fresh cranberries are very low in carbs and high in fiber
  • 1 cup of cranberries has 12 grams of carbs
  • They are full of phytonutrients and antioxidants
  • They are anti-inflammatory
  • Cranberries are high in vitamin C
  • Beware of dried cranberries, as they are usually full of added sugars.

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 325F and line a muffin tin with parchment or silicone liners.

  • Combine sour cream, eggs, and vanilla extract in a large blender jar. Blend about 30 seconds.

  • Add the almond flour, sweetener, baking powder, cinnamon, and salt. Blend again until smooth, about 30 seconds to a minute. If your batter is overly thick, add ¼ to ½ cup of water to thin it out (different brands of almond flour can vary).

  • By hand, stir in cranberries, keeping a few for the top of the muffins, and chopped pecans if using. Divide the mixture among the prepared muffin cups and bake 25 to 30 minutes, until just golden brown and firm to the touch.

  • Remove and let cool completely.
